Dent Repair Can Add Value To Your Automotive!

Repairing dents of any dimension is a quick and easy way to spice up the worth of a car. Most body shops can fix dents ranging in dimension from small to giant and it is estimated that this repair will increase the value of a car as much as $1,000. While the mechanical functions of a car needs to be the priority, most people purchase a used vehicle based mostly on its look and assumed maintenance. A car should always have dents of any size repaired before selling.

How Repairing Dents Will increase Value

It is well known that small touches may also help a automobile sell for more. Cleaning wheels and interior, fixing burnt out lights and waxing a automotive improve the appearance and the value for very little money. Dent repair is analogous; it is a small investment that may yield a big return. A very good body shop can use a method known as paintless dent repair (PDR) to fix dings without the necessity to repaint. This is without doubt one of the finest investments to make in a used car earlier than selling and is usually used by rental agencies, dealerships and auctions to organize a vehicle for sale.

How the Approach Works

Paintless repair of dents is a method that may repair depressions within the metal. A technician at a body shop uses particular instruments to control the metal back into its authentic form from behind the dent, causing no damage to the paint. The panel is accessed by removing trim items or by way of interior panels. This method can only be performed by a trained PDR technician and requires experience. The dent is removed by working from the outside edges in, slowly decreasing the scale till it becomes so small it blends in with the paint texture.

What Dent Repair Can Fix

Typically, dent repair by a professional can fix virtually any dent from very large to small. The paintless approach works finest on 1990 and newer car models because of the type of paint and frame used. This approach is only recommended for dents if the paint just isn't cracked or broken as well. Lastly, the dent should not be close to the sting of a panel and the world should not have any earlier body repair work that has changed the integrity of the panel.

Advantages of Fixing Dents

There are various advantages to repairing dents in a vehicle earlier than sale. There isn't any repainting or filler needed, which removes the chance of paint overspray on other areas of the vehicle. This also eliminates the necessity to match paint colours and permits the vehicle to retain its original paint. Vehicles with authentic paint have a greater resale worth than repainted vehicles. Repairing dents with the paintless approach can be much more affordable than traditional body work and some insurance firms even waive deductibles when this technique is used.

Many body shops at the moment make use of trained PDR technicians to remove dents affordably and safely. This approach is the number one way to extend a car's worth before selling because it raises the value an important deal for a small investment. Dents of all sizes may be repaired with this approach and the associated fee is usually under $a hundred and fifty at a professional body shop. Though the process cannot remove all dents, it's one of the best way to take care of the integrity and authentic coloration of a vehicle while making it as attractive as possible for resale.
